Duties/Responsibilities
Responsible for providing direct outreach, vulnerability screening, escort, and referral services for all homeless individuals encountered in the field during their shift. Also responsible for recording and maintaining accurate statistical data on all individuals approached and referred as well as case-record management of clients receiving longer-term services. Recognize the signs and symptoms of mental health and substance abuse issues and gain a working knowledge of all available services.
In addition, Transit System Based Outreach Specialists will spend the majority of outreach to homeless individuals at end of the line stations with a high level of collaborative joint outreach operations with various external agencies. Related Duties as assigned.
Hours
Full-time 37.5 hours per week

Program Description
Jointly funded by the Department of Homeless Services and the Metropolitan Transportation Authority, BRC's Transit Homeless Outreach staff members operate throughout the transit system 24 hours a day.
